17

私の質問は非常に簡単です:

firefoxのインライン要素でマージントップが無視されるのはなぜですか?

誰か知っていますか?

4

2 に答える 2

23

これは Firefox 専用ではなく、CSS 2.1 仕様で定義されています。

8.3 マージン プロパティ: 'margin-top'、'margin-right'、'margin-bottom'、'margin-left'、および 'margin'

マージン プロパティは、ボックスのマージン領域の幅を指定します。'margin' 省略形プロパティは 4 つの辺すべての余白を設定しますが、他の余白プロパティはそれぞれの辺のみを設定します。これらのプロパティはすべての要素に適用されますが、垂直マージンは置換されていないインライン要素には影響しません。

(最後の強調は私のものです;margin-topは縦の余白です)

于 2012-04-25T22:16:47.903 に答える